20 miles south of Jerusalem, and the same distance north of Beersheba. It is now called El Khalil, `the well-beloved,' the usual epithet which the Turks and Arabs apply to Abraham, whose sepulchral cave they still shew; over which St. Helena built a magnificent church. Its original site was on an eminence, at the southern foot of which the present village is pleasantly situated, on which are the remains of an ancient castle, its sole defence.
